Right now I'm reading the House of Night series, and they're very good. I'm only on four, but as far as I know there are seven with an eighth book coming soon.

Basically, Zoey Redbird becomes marked, which means that she will turn into a vampire. She has to go to a new school for vampires, the House of Night. If she doesn't, she dies. When she get's there, she makes friends quickly, and life is good. But nothing is ever how it seems, and neither are the people. Zoey is the chosen one, who has to stop all the evil going on there. Her goddess has chosen her.

Any way, after that I plan on reading Old Magic. The back descprition looks good, but I don't know anyone who's read it.

I'm currently reading the Fablehaven series and its so good! I just finished the first book and I'm already crazy over this series.

It's kinda of for children but don't let that stop you! I totally didn't see it that way at all, its a fantastic series. It's basically like Spiderwick and Harry Potter combined in a way. Even in just the first book, tons of creatures were involved.

It follows two kids, Kendra and Seth, as the wind up having to stay with their grandparents for a couple of weeks. Their grandpa owns a huge piece of land and is mainly out taking care of it, but the kids have no clue how important his job is. Until they figure out certain secrets about where they are staying and what their grandpa's job really is.

Ffff. I always read a whole bunch of books at once.

The God of Small Things
by Arundhati Roy: about two Indian twins and their horribly depressing lives. Crazy interesting and non-linear and internal monologues.
Warrior Queen
by Alan Gold: The life of Queen Bouddica in novel form.
The Graveyard Book
by Neil Gaiman: Like The Jungle Book but with ghosts. I love Neil Gaiman, he's my favourite author.
Sophie's World
by Jostein Gaarder: My Peruvian aunt insisted that this was a fantastic book and that I just had to read it. But so far I'm just finding it cheesy. Maybe cheesy is a coveted writing style in Norweigan/Peruvian literature.
Pride and Prejudice and Zombies
by Jane Austen & Seth Grahame-Smith: Just as it's called. C:
El Coronel no tiene quien le escriba
by Gabriel García Márquez: I have no idea what this is about! My Spanish is horrible, and that's why I'm reading it, but all I've managed to unearth is that the colonel ran out of coffee, something about a civil war, and then his wife walked into the kitchen. I can't even figure out what the title means. "The colonel doesn't have who writes to him?" I'm sure this is some common idiom in Spanish BUT I DON'T KNOW WHAT IT MEANS. >:U
